    What is an Area Agency on Aging?

    An Area Agency on Aging (AAA) is a local organization funded under the Older Americans Act that coordinates services for adults 60+ in Tennessee. Use the county lookup above to find yours.

    How do I find home care or meal delivery near me?

    Contact your local AAA or call the Eldercare Locator at 1-800-677-1116. They can connect you with home-delivered meals, in-home care, and other services based on your county.

    What is SHIP / Medicare counseling?

    The State Health Insurance Assistance Program (SHIP) provides free, unbiased Medicare counseling. Trained counselors help you understand your coverage options, compare plans, and file appeals.
